The Role

As a Grants & Contracts Manager, you will oversee a range of funding and fundraising activities, as well as ensuring effective contract management.

Specifically, you will be involved in developing and managing funding applications, creating compelling funding bids for statutory, trust and foundation sources.

You will work with the Head of Contract Development, Grants & Contracts Co-ordinator and leadership teams, steward relationships with funders and lead the initial stages of new funding agreements.

You will ensure compliance with funding requirements, track reporting, and monitor processes.

Additionally, you will:

- Research and submit tenders and funding applications, including budget development
- Maintain and improve fundraising systems, including CRM management
- Support the delivery of LGBT Foundation’s annual business planning and budgeting

About You

To be considered as a Grants & Contracts Manager, you will need:

- Experience of writing and submitting successful funding applications to trusts, foundations, and statutory sources
- Experience of analysing and preparing financial information and presenting it in accessible formats
- Previous line management experience
- Excellent communication skills with the ability to write compelling, clear applications and reports
- Strong time-management, organisational and IT skills, including the use of Microsoft 365 and CRM systems
- A commitment to equality, diversity and understanding the issues faced by LGBTQ+ communities

Company

We believe in a fair and equal society where all LGBT people can achieve their full potential. #EqualityWins underpins much of what we do and we aim to be; ‘here if you need us.’

We are a nationally significant charity firmly rooted in our local communities of Greater Manchester and provide a wide range of evidence-based and cost effective services.

Each year, we serve over 40,000 people, achieving an average 98% satisfaction rating, as well as providing information to over 600,000 individuals online. As a result, we serve more LGBT people than any other charity of our kind in the UK.

Throughout all of our work, we support LGBT people to increase their skills, knowledge and self-confidence to improve and maintain their health and wellbeing. We also work in partnership with others to build strong, cohesive and influential LGBT communities.

Working together, we are changing LGBT lives for the better and securing a safe, equal and healthy future for all LGBT people.
